OverviewThis book contains step-by-step instructions for carving and painting a magnificent bird of prey. The latest entry in ""Wildfowl Carving Magazine's"" popular Workbench Projects series offers easy-to-follow, step-by-step instructions and photographs that explain how to carve half-size osprey from start to finish. Carvers will find this informative book providing everything they need including complete lists of tools and paints, valuable tips and techniques, and detailed photographs to guide them along.
